Design Fees. In the event that during the term of this Agreement Medtronic requests that WGL supply to it a new model or models of SVO Battery under this Agreement, then Medtronic will pay to WGL a reasonable design fee for WGL's efforts in designing such new model or models of SVO Battery. Such design fee shall be mutually agreed to by the parties in good faith and in no event will such fee be greater than an amount equal in all material respects to that being paid at or near the time of such design changes by other purchasers for a comparable degree of design changes to SVO Batteries purchased from WGL. Any significant design changes for SVO Batteries in production shall cost a minimum of *.

Design Fees. The Design Phase begins upon approval of Discovery. The purpose of the Design Phase is to develop final site design and navigation. Design is a collaborative process between the customer and a Designer. The Design Phase begins with a meeting between the customer and the Project Manager. Topics discussed in this meeting are site "look and feel", navigation and business requirements. This is a creative session. Any preconceived or preexisting graphical concepts that the customer has will be considered for incorporation into the site design. Customer expectations should allow for a minimum two-week Design phase. This phase will be longer if corporate image and branding, character development or animation is a project requirement. The Designer develops initial sketches from input received in the Design meeting. Upon customer approval of initial sketches, the Designer develops design "comps." The customer has the opportunity to select from these design choices and make adjustments to the design as needed. The Designer will then develop a final site design from the customer's selection. The Design Phase concludes when the customer showing acceptance of the final design signs the OneWeb Systems Design Approval form. Changes to the design from this point forward are mutually agreed upon by OneWeb Systems and the customer and are documented using the OneWeb Systems Change Control form. Design Phase Deliverables include: - Design Meeting - Initial Sketches - Three Design Comps - One Final Site Design Design Fee: $25,000.00
Design Fees. All design fees and planning fees associated with the Store Improvements shall be incurred solely by XXXXXX & XXXXX, and XXXXXX & XXXXX shall treat all design and planning fees as XXXXXX & NOBLE’s operating expenses. Design fees and planning fees shall not be included as part of the Facility Investment to be depreciated.
